Summary

Rail Vision Ltd. (NASDAQ: RVSN), a development-stage technology company aiming to revolutionize railway safety and data markets through artificial intelligence, has achieved a significant milestone through its majority-owned subsidiary Quantum Transportation Ltd. The subsidiary successfully implemented its transformer-based neural decoder on the AWS cloud, marking a crucial step toward real-world quantum applications in transportation. This deployment follows the recent unveiling of Quantum Transportation's transformer neural decoder, which reportedly outperformed classical quantum error correction algorithms in simulations, and the delivery of its first universal error correction prototype. The cloud-based implementation enables collaboration with quantum hardware partners and supports direct testing of its code-agnostic decoder on physical quantum systems, with potential long-term applications in railway anomaly detection, predictive maintenance, and autonomous operations. Rail Vision completed its acquisition of a 51% stake in Quantum Transportation on January 14, 2026, through a share exchange transaction, solidifying its position in the emerging quantum computing space.
